International School of Los Angeles
Burbank, Los Angeles •Co-Education •- from 2
- to 18 years old
School type: International School - Private SchoolCurriculum: American Curriculum - French Curriculum - IB CurriculumLanguage of instruction: Bilingual - English - FrenchYearly fee: from 19,995 to 24,900 USD
Foundation: 1978Nationalities: 65 different nationalitiesNr of students: 65 studentsExaminations: French Baccalaureate - IB DiplomaThe International School of Los Angeles (LILA) is a non-profit, independent, international school committed to bilingual education and academic excellence in a nurturing environment.Preschool (Harmonized Bilingual Program), Middle School (Bilingual Program), High School (Baccalauréat Français or International Baccalaureate Diploma)Annual tuition fees at International School of Los Angeles range from USD 19,995 to USD 24,900, depending on the student’s grade level and program.

How much does it cost to attend International Schools in Burbank?
The yearly tuition fees for International Schools in Burbank generally range from $15,000 to $25,000 per year. This cost can vary based on factors like the curriculum, the quality of campus facilities, the standard of boarding, and the services – with some top-tier schools exceeding $30,000 annually.
Category | Low Range | High Range |
|---|---|---|
Annual Tuition | $15,000 | $25,000 |
Monthly Tuition Equivalent | $1,250 | $2,100 |
Registration Fee (one-time) | $500 | $1,000 |
Uniforms & Materials | $200 | $400 |
Extras & Trips | $500 | $1,000 |
Total Est. Annual Cost | $17,200 | $28,400 |
